- Role Summary
- In this role, you will perform maintenance, troubleshooting, inspections, and modifications on MH-139 aircraft and related systems. The position requires hands-on expertise with aircraft tools and equipment, the ability to diagnose and repair complex systems, and the flexibility to work multiple shifts. Technicians will ensure all work meets flight worthiness, safety, and compliance standards, while contributing to the success and readiness of this critical defense program.

- Job Duties/Functions
- Mechanic, Avionics & Structures positions available
- Assembles, disassembles, and/or modifies systems by changing, removing, replacing, or upgrading aerospace vehicle components to correct failures or implement changes
- Oversees assembly, disassembly, or overhaul
- Configures aerospace vehicles and bench test equipment
- Troubleshoots complex pneumatic, hydraulic, and electrical systems to isolate mechanical or electrical faults and repair faulty components.
- Performs validation/verification testing of systems and components
- Documents procedures and established processes to ensure contractual and regulatory compliance (e.g., repairs, test results, applicable modifications, and inspection results)
- Inspects components and verifies repairs for flight-worthiness requirements
- Works under general direction
